Ferrotec vs Ichor Holdings
Ferrotec's primary segment is Sputtering Targets; Ichor Holdings's is Subsystems & Components. Ferrotec is larger by market cap ($3.1B vs $1.9B). Ferrotec reports higher tracked revenue ($1.9B vs $948M).
Shared segment: Equipment (Front End).
